Leases Leases
We have operating leases for our corporate and division offices, production facilities, model homes, and certain office and production equipment. Additionally, we have finance leases for certain production equipment and facilities which are recorded in homebuilding "Property, plant and equipment, net" and "Accrued expenses and other liabilities" on the accompanying condensed consolidated balance sheets. Our finance lease right-of-use ("ROU") assets and finance lease liabilities were $37,314 and $40,244, respectively, as of June 30, 2025, and $37,638 and $40,036, respectively, as of December 31, 2024. Our leases have remaining lease terms of up to 15.2 years, some of which include options to extend the lease for up to 20 years, and some of which include options to terminate the lease.
We recognize operating lease expense on a straight-line basis over the lease term. We have elected to use the portfolio approach for certain equipment leases which have similar lease terms and payment schedules. Additionally, for certain equipment we account for the lease and non-lease components as a single lease component. Our sublease income is de minimis.
We have certain leases, primarily the leases of model homes, which have initial lease terms of twelve months or less ("Short-term leases"). We elected to exclude these leases from the recognition requirements under Topic 842, and these leases have not been included in our recognized ROU assets and lease liabilities.
